Inhomogeneous Energy - Density Driven Instability in Presence of a Transverse DC Electric Fields in a Magnetized Plasma Cylinder
Abstract
Temporal evolution of the inhomogeneous energy density driven instability (IEDDI) is examined in presence of a nonuniform transverse dc electric field in collisional magnetized plasma cylinder. Using experimentally known parameters relevant to IEDDI, we have estimated the growth rate for $ν$=1, 2 and 3 nonlocal eigenmodes.
